Profile: Snowden Associates is a Management and public relations services company located at Washington, North Carolina USA, address is 200 Commerce Sq, Washington 27889-4987 NC, postcode is 27889-4987
Please share as much information as you can about Snowden Associates so other users can benefit from your comment.